What is the difference between Boat Design vs Marine Engineering?

AspectBoat DesignMarine Engineering
Primary FocusCreating the conceptual and detailed design of boats and shipsDeveloping and maintaining the mechanical systems and propulsion of ships
Required CredentialsDegree in Naval Architecture, Marine Design, or related fieldsDegree in Marine Engineering, Mechanical Engineering, or related fields
Work EnvironmentDesign studios, shipyards, officesShipyards, offshore facilities, engineering offices
Industry UsageUsed by naval architects and boat buildersUsed by marine engineers and ship operators

Boat Design focuses on creating the aesthetic and structural aspects of boats, while Marine Engineering emphasizes the mechanical systems and propulsion. Both roles are essential in shipbuilding but differ in their core responsibilities and expertise.

About Us

Underwater, the wireless transfer of a single picture used to take an hour. We brought to market wireless modems that transfer data 100 to 1000 times faster. Legacy modems were basically status/command links; our modems can control undersea drones with live video feedback - a game changer for exploring the underwater world. Because radio waves attenuate quickly underwater, our modems use sound waves to communicate.
